Background

  • Open fracture is common due to minimal amount of subcutaneous tissue
  • Fibula is often fractured as well

Clinical Features

  • Localized pain/swelling
  • Inability to bear weight

Treatment

  • Long leg posterior splint
    • Knee at 5 degrees flexion, foot in slight plantarflexion
  • Rule-out compartment syndrome

Disposition

  • Consider discharge if low-energy injury and pt not at risk of compartment syndrome
